Washington Monument – Francis Scott Key Bridge loop from Fairfax

04:04

68.4km

390m

Cycling

Moderate bike ride. Good fitness required. Mostly paved surfaces. Suitable for all skill levels. The starting point of the route is accessible with public transport.

Theodore Roosevelt Bridge

Highlight • Bridge

The Theodore Roosevelt Bridge crosses over the Potomac River. It is both a pedestrian way and cycle way. The bridge is named after Theodore Roosevelt or Teddy Roosevelt, the 26th President of the United States.

Francis Scott Key Bridge

Highlight • Bridge

This is a paved path across the bridge with metal railings separating pedestrians/cyclists from vehicular traffic. It feels safe but it can be a little loud. The views are beautiful.
